safari won't let me email a webpage

I am using the latest version of Safari in Mountain Lion and using Apple Mail. I tried sending the webpage I was viewing by clicking on the little envelope on the menu bar and a box pops up saying that it can't send the email and that I should us Apple Mail and may have to re-install Mac OS. Any idea how to fix this?
I attached a screen shot.

That is odd. I just added the email quick link and it works well here. It brings up an email the same way the share icon does. I don't see any preferences specific to that either.

Do you have another mail program installed by any chance? Like thunderbird? Perhaps you have another browser set to email via another app, and that's interfering with the specific email icon in Safari?

Have a look in Mail Preferences under Composing, see what you have set for "Send new Message From" entry. If you select your default email account there, then Safari will use that email account to send email. There may be something funky there?

I think that was it. I have used Postbox in the past and still have it on my system. What I did was go into Mail preferences and then switch the default to Postbox. I tried sending the link and Postbox opened up. I then went back into Mail and switched back to Mail as the default composer and then went to Safari and now when I click the link Mail opens!
